Tumor Immunity Microenvironment-based classifications of bladder cancer for enhancing cancer immunotherapy

<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> <h4>Background</h4> Bladder cancer is composed by a mass of heterogenetic characteristics, immunotherapy is a potential way to save the life of bladder cancer patients, but only benefit to about 20% patients. <h4>Methods and materials</h4> A total of 4003 bladder cancer patients from 19 cohorts was enrolled in this study, collecting the clinical information and mRNA expression profile.
